The Maria Callas Museum Live Music Sessions

From January to June 2026, the Maria Callas Museum presents the Songs from the Third Floor series: a monthly encounter with contemporary Greek music creation, curated by radio producer Giorgos Florakis (ERT Third Programme, Kosmos 93.6). Set in a unique atmosphere on the museum’s third floor, each session features a different artist and takes the audience into a different musical genre, turning each evening into a ritual-like experience: a dialogue around music, the personal story of each creator, and the immediacy of live performance.

Biography / Foivos Delivorias

Foivos Delivorias was born in Kallithea, Athens, in 1973. He began studying classical guitar with Orfeas Peridis and, at just sixteen years old, presented his first songs to Manos Hadjidakis, which led to the release of his debut album I Parelasi on the legendary Seirios label.

Since 1989, he has released a series of albums that established him as one of Greece’s most important singer-songwriters, known for his deeply personal style and distinctive lyrical voice. Through a songwriting language entirely his own, Delivorias captures everyday life with immediacy, sensitivity, and poetic clarity, creating songs that remain timeless.

He has presented numerous original live performances in Greece and abroad, collaborating with leading artists across disciplines. In 2017, he created I Taratsa tou Foivou, a contemporary music-theatre spectacle that became a hallmark of Athenian summers through 2025. In 2022, he introduced the musical comedy Ta Noumera on Greek public television, based on an original concept in which he also starred.
